Do you get anxious or worried easily? Often?

Last night's devotion, from "Taste and See: Savoring the Supremacy of God in all of Life", was about such things, and Piper brought to light an idea I'd never pondered before.

We know that God has a plan for our lives and we trust that. He is in control of all, and thus we really have no need to worry.

However, we're humans and we often worry. Because we know it's sin, when we realize we are worrying, we confess and try to leave our issues in God's hands. That's often really hard, especially if it's something that can possibly have major consequences.

Piper's insight, hopefully, will effect this sinful human's reaction the next time she catches herself worrying. Here it is... When we see that there is a reason to be anxious or worry, God has ALREADY placed a plan in motion to deal with the issue/situation!

Ponder on that for a moment. See if it doesn't significantly effect your worry habit.
